plasma intel gpu monitor
v0.3.1
显示Intel GPU使用情况(包括视频加速度或不使用视频加速)的等离子体小部件


工具提示

Intel-GPU-Tools软件包
给intel_gpu_top使用sudo setcap cap_perfmon=+ep /usr/bin/intel_gpu_top使用sedo setcap cap_perfmon = gpu_gpu_top的能力,或者您可以使用以下SystemD单元
create /etc/systemd/system/setcap_intel_gpu_top.service with:
[Unit]
Description =Set intel_gpu_top perfmon capabilities
After =graphical.target
[Service]
ExecStart =/sbin/setcap cap_perfmon =+ep /usr/bin/intel_gpu_top
Type =oneshot
RemainAfterExit =yes
[Install]
WantedBy =graphical.target启动并启用服务
sudo systemctl enable --now setcap_intel_gpu_top.service在诸如Ubuntu之类的系统中,默认情况下,性能事件监视是禁用的。要使intel_gpu_top无需root工作,您需要将/proc/sys/kernel/perf_event_paranoid设置为2。否则,您可能会遇到这样的错误:
$ intel_gpu_top
Failed to initialize PMU ! (Permission denied)
...要解决这个问题,通过运行sudo sysctl kernel.perf_event_paranoid=2将偏执量降低至2
为了使其永久创建file /etc/sysctl.d/99-sysctl-paranoid.conf ,并带有以下内容
kernel.perf_event_paranoid = 2最后,运行intel_gpu_top验证其有效
Render/3D , Video & VideoEnhance , Blitter ) Get new widgets..重要的
在安装脚本之前,更新了main分支以支持等离子体6,以从等离子体5运行git checkout kf5中安装。
安装这些依赖项(请让我知道我错过或添加了一些不必要的东西)
cmake extra-cmake-modules libplasma intel-gpu-tools运行./install.sh
如果您喜欢该项目,请考虑捐赠/赞助此和我的其他开源工作
在Github上给它一颗星星
KDE商店的评价/评论